Output f3641395da140d47e05186115a617af1bfe3262cc4d3995deb32aef1dce5ea87:29

value
1526253841
script pubkey
OP_0 OP_PUSHBYTES_32 06ac7ce5d7dedb572b50c73efbd29920aaf167f1c866f1da8acba1cffce88e61
address
bc1qq6k8eewhmmd4w26scul0h55eyz40zel3epn0rk52ewsull8g3ess35clft
transaction
f3641395da140d47e05186115a617af1bfe3262cc4d3995deb32aef1dce5ea87
spent
true